Or the 24.99 to efile a state return?
There is a lot of confusion about this. For the Desktop version it's a free download of one state PROGRAM, not returns filed. You can prepare unlimited federal and unlimited state returns. Some people need to file in more than one state so they have to buy another state program. You can print and mail the state for free or each state is 19.99 early or 24.99 to efile. If you buy the cd at the store the Basic version does not include the state. And Deluxe is available both with and without the state. Because some states don't have an income tax.
The State is $24.99 each to efile but it is free to print and mail unlimited returns. And to have the 24.99 fee deducted from your federal refund is an EXTRA 39.99 Refund Transfer fee. Or you can use a credit card and avoid the extra charge.

@skipborg1 Yes there is a 24.99 fee to efile the state return from the Desktop program. There is a lot of confusion about this. For the Desktop versions Deluxe and above, it's a free download of one state preparation PROGRAM, not returns filed. You can prepare unlimited federal and unlimited state returns. You can print and mail the state for free or each state return (including the first one) is 19.99 until March, then goes to 24.99.
Box says Federal Returns & Federal E-File plus State returns. It does not say state efiling is included. It also says on the back on my CD case in the chart comparing the versions - 1 state product via download (print free or efile for $19.99 each) prices subject to change without notice.
